php unoconv 没有返回值
时间: 2023-09-22 21:03:11 浏览: 141
有参数无返回值的函数
5星 · 资源好评率100%
php unoconv 是一个用于将文档格式进行转换的工具,它可以将各种文档格式(如DOC、DOCX、PDF等)相互转换。但是,需要注意的是,php unoconv 并没有返回值。
通常情况下,我们可以通过在 PHP 中使用 exec() 函数来调用 unoconv 命令行工具。例如:
$command = "unoconv --format=pdf file.docx";
exec($command, $output, $return_var);
在上述例子中,通过执行 unoconv 命令将 file.docx 文件转换为 PDF 格式。然后,通过 exec() 函数执行该命令,并将输出结果保存在 $output 数组中,返回值保存在 $return_var 变量中。
然而,需要注意的是,unoconv 命令行工具本身并没有直接返回值。执行 unoconv 命令后,它可能会产生一些输出信息,例如执行成功与否的提示信息。但这些信息并不是返回值,而是输出到标准输出流中,并不会被 exec() 函数获取到。
因此,如果我们想要获取 unoconv 的执行结果,通常需要通过分析 $output 数组中的输出信息来判断执行是否成功,或者通过检查 $return_var 变量的值来判断执行结果。这样,我们可以根据具体的需求来进行处理和判断。
综上所述,php unoconv 并不具备直接返回值的功能。要获取它的执行结果,需要通过 exec() 函数获取输出信息和返回值,并根据需要来处理。
阅读全文